Facts about It's The Same Old Dream

✔️

Who wrote It's The Same Old Dream lyrics?


It's The Same Old Dream is written by Jule Styne, Sammy Cahn.
✔️

When was It's The Same Old Dream released?


It is first released on December 18, 1990 as part of Frank Sinatra's album "The Capitol Years" which includes 50 tracks in total. This song is the 46th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is It's The Same Old Dream?


It's The Same Old Dream falls under the genre Vocal.
✔️

How long is the song It's The Same Old Dream?


It's The Same Old Dream song length is 3 minutes and 03 seconds.
